Assume that you are the marketing director for a computer parts manufacturer that wants to use rebates as a promotional tool. Explain what rebate fraud is and how you would possibly control this problem.

Answer to Question 1

Rebate fraud occurs by manufacturers, retailers, and consumers themselves. Manufacturers commit fraud when promoting rebate offers but then failing to fulfill them when consumers submit rebate slips with accompanying proofs of purchase. Retailers sometimes advertise attractive rebates but then do not disclose (or disclose only in fine print) that the rebates will not arrive for several months or that the consumer must purchase another item to be eligible for the rebate. Consumers undertake their own form of rebate-related fraud. There is a huge amount of fraud associated with bogus claims paid out to professional rebaters. Fraud occurs when professionals acquire their own cash registers, generate phony cash-register receipts, and send them on to manufacturers to collect refund checks without making the required product purchases.

Postal authorities and marketers are taking aggressive efforts to curtail refunding fraud, such as stating on the refund/rebate forms that they will not send checks to post office boxes, stating that checks will be mailed only to the return address listed on the envelope, and stipulating that printed mailing labels are prohibited.

Did you know?

People with alcoholism are at a much greater risk of malnutrition than are other people and usually exhibit low levels of most vitamins (especially folic acid). This is because alcohol often takes the place of 50% of their daily intake of calories, with little nutritional value contained in it.

Did you know?

Most strokes are caused when blood clots move to a blood vessel in the brain and block blood flow to that area. Thrombolytic therapy can be used to dissolve the clot quickly. If given within 3 hours of the first stroke symptoms, this therapy can help limit stroke damage and disability.
